Exam Structure And Core Domains
The Industrial Maintenance Mechanic Certified Exam Assesses Candidates’ Knowledge And Practical Skills Across Essential Industrial Maintenance Functions. It Typically Consists Of Multiple-Choice Questions Covering Critical Domains Necessary For An Industrial Maintenance Mechanic’s Role.
The Core Domains Of The IMM Exam Include:
Equipment Installation & Repair
Preventive Maintenance & Troubleshooting
Hydraulics, Pneumatics & Mechanical Systems
Electrical Systems & Industrial Safety
Each Section Evaluates A Candidate’s Ability To Apply Technical Knowledge To Real-World Maintenance Scenarios, Making Thorough Preparation Crucial.
IMM Study Tips
What's the best study strategy for IMM?
Focus on weak areas first. Use practice tests to identify gaps, then study those topics intensively.
How far in advance should I start studying?
Most successful candidates begin 4-8 weeks before the exam. Create a structured study schedule.
Should I retake practice tests?
Yes! Take each practice test 2-3 times. Focus on understanding why answers are correct, not memorizing.
What should I do on exam day?
Arrive 30 min early, bring required ID, read questions carefully, flag difficult ones, and review before submitting.

How To Prepare For The Industrial Maintenance Mechanic Certified Exam
Preparing For The Industrial Maintenance Mechanic Certified Exam Requires Both Study And Hands-On Experience. Candidates Should Focus On Mastering Each Domain By Using Study Guides, Technical Manuals, And Practice Tests Tailored To The Exam.
Topics To Review Include Mechanical Systems, Hydraulic Circuits, Pneumatic Operations, And Electrical Safety Protocols. Practical Experience In Diagnosing Issues And Completing Preventive Maintenance Tasks Is Essential, As Many Exam Questions Involve Applying Situational Judgment.
Consider Joining IMM Preparation Courses Or Workshops, Which Offer Updated Study Materials And Simulated Exam Environments. Consistent Practice And Review Will Significantly Improve Your Chances Of Passing On The First Attempt.
